Sat 1298421254051553

decimal
309368.1254051553
degree
0°99368′920″1254051553‴
percentile
61.829583594277004%
name
eqplmfaxbeu
cycle
0
epoch
1
period
153
block
309368
offset
1254051553
timestamp
rarity
common
inscriptions
location
23df8247da607597829c2578975d0a6abd67eb89d0659894832860b9e30d9db6:3:0
address
bc1pvcgj8ylf0lfft0hgc9nq7m9t460krak7vpzx6pxmfp6za8uazgpq5nnz2s